We used to ream the head tube after welding and first truing.

1

u/Informal_Mistake7530 Jul 19 '26

I agree but most of the integrated head tubes are pre machined so they would just take a light touch with the reamer after welding to clean it up.

1

u/Efficient-Webs Jul 19 '26

The outfit I worked for was a custom frame builder a million years ago, so my knowledge is certainly uselessly out of date. Cheers.

1

u/Informal_Mistake7530 Jul 20 '26

No! You are spot on. My guess is you were working with steel. The aluminum head tubes are machined with internal bearing seat and then touched by the cutter to spec after welding. Same process just that the aluminum head tubes are a lot thicker and easier to rough in before welding. Where did you work if you don’t mind saying.

u/Substantial-Fun-48 Jul 18 '26 edited Jul 18 '26

Understood. To make it right, you will need to source a taller bearing for the lower cup which you’ll have to source from a bearing manufacturer/distributor. Pain in the but to look for a needle in a haystack, but the headset relies on angular contact and compression vertically. Deda standard is 51.9 OD x 40 ID x 8mm tall 45 deg x 45 deg, but you can safely do 51 OD to widen your search and the angular edge will still make good contact

Bike shop owner here.

So there could be a couple things going on u/Diligent_Gas990

1) the headtube could be reamed more on the lower than the upper. I doubt that's it though.
2) you could have the bearings in wrong. Many times the headset bearings, there are two size. One of them, the ID is larger than other. This allows the top cover (the plastic piece on top of the upper bearing) to sit lower and flush with the top of the headtube.
If flipped, meaning the one that should be on top is on the bottom, it means the fork crown would fit really closely or even touch the bottom of the headtube. Which is what it looks like in your picture.

My guess is number 2. It happens often that people don't realize there are two different bearings. I've done it while not paying attention.

I would pull the fork and measure the ID of the bearings. If it is the reaming of the headtube, that would surprise me. And the only thing you can do to fix that, ream the upper more so the top cover sits flush. And face the bottom of the headtube so the fork doesn't touch the frame. Of course you would need very special tools for this or a bike shop near you with the tools.
